Are you a Social Sciences or Law Early Career Researcher or PhD student looking to engage with companies?  The Universities of Exeter & Bristol and the SWDTP are collaborating to provide this fully funded training programme that will equip participants with the tools, skills and confidence required to work more effectively with or in industry. It provides a working knowledge of key business issues that impact commercial organisations, which is valuable whether you plan to pursue a career in industry or collaborate with industry as part of a career in academic research.

Content

Connecting with Industry is a certificated, interactive on-line programme that equips participants with the tools, skills and confidence required to work more effectively with or in industry. It provides a working knowledge of key business issues that impact commercial organisations, which is valuable whether you plan to pursue a career in industry or collaborate with industry as part of a career in academic research.


Conversations with Industry is a series of facilitated group discussions with professionals experienced working in, or with industry in a variety of different roles. The “Conversations” are live and interactive with diverse guests who provide context, inspiration and real-world stories that bring key learnings to life. The “Conversations” also offer the opportunity for participants to expand their network and build relationships with key industry contacts.


The optional mentor coaching session following the training will offer participants one-to-one guidance immediately relevant to their personal situation. This helps build momentum in a specific area, whether it’s exploring career options, starting a business, commercialising research or connecting with potential partners. This provides an opportunity to gain additional insight, receive individual feedback and expand your network and connections in industry. Coaching is a proven approach to drive rich learning and development and can have a significant impact on your progression after the programme.

Delivery

This training programme will be delivered by Skillfluence, specialists in transferable skills training that equips Researchers to work with others, both inside and outside of academia.
Zoom will be used for live sessions, mentoring conversations will take place on Zoom, Teams, Skype or by phone.

  • Pre-course content & course schedule made available prior to course
  • 6  live weekly sessions with 4 x Conversations (weeks 2-5)
  • Post-session tasks to apply learning to own situation, generate outputs and find relevance
  • Submission of outputs for certification at the end of the programme
  • • Optional Mentor Coaching Conversations offered in week 7/8, bookings open approximately week 4.
